More about field assistant courses in Northern Territory

For those seeking a career in environmental conservation, Field Assistant courses in Northern Territory present an excellent opportunity to gain the necessary skills and knowledge to thrive in this vital role. As a Field Assistant, you will support activities ranging from ecological research to habitat restoration, playing a crucial part in maintaining the natural balance of the Northern Territory's unique ecosystems. By enrolling in these courses, you can set a solid foundation for a fulfilling career devoted to the environment.

A variety of related roles are available within the environmental sector should you choose to expand your career path. For instance, becoming an Environmental Consultant or Conservation Trainee allows you to delve into strategic planning and implementation of sustainability initiatives. If your interests lie in research and analysis, consider pursuing a position as an Ecologist or an Environmental Manager, both critical in ensuring legislative compliance and ecological awareness in Northern Territory's unique environments.

Additionally, the skills acquired from Field Assistant courses can lead you towards roles such as an Environmental Specialist or Conservation Officer. These positions are essential for implementing conservation measures and educating the public on environmental stewardship. Furthermore, pursuing a career as an Environmental Educator or an Environmental Advocate can empower you to foster a greater awareness and understanding of environmental issues within local communities.

As the demand for sustainability grows, the role of a Field Assistant may also lead to opportunities as a Sustainability Consultant. This role would have a significant impact on guiding businesses and organizations in Northern Territory towards sustainable practices, ultimately benefiting the local economy and environment. With a variety of pathways available, enrolling in Field Assistant courses in Northern Territory not only equips you with essential skills but also opens doors to numerous fulfilling careers within the environmental sector.
